Prioritizing Health Equity
Health equity is not a luxury—it is a fundamental necessity. Millions depend on health equity initiatives that aim not merely to correct disparities but to reset societal norms toward fairness. Such initiatives hold the promise of significantly enhancing the quality of life for historically underserved groups, especially Black women, who often face compounded barriers in healthcare access and outcomes. Health equity also stands as a beacon of hope for Native Americans, Hispanic Americans, Asian Americans, LGBTQ+ individuals, and people living with disabilities, each confronting unique challenges in our healthcare system.
